The Last of Us Part 2 Remastered PC Version Now Available for Pre-load on Steam

The PC version of The Last of Us Part 2 Remastered is now available for pre-load on Steam. The download size is approximately 100 GB.
The The Last of Us Part 2 Remastered PC port, developed by Nixxes Software and Iron Galaxy Studios, is launching on April 3rd on both Steam and EGS. This version features enhanced graphics, unlocked framerates, DualSense controller support, ultrawide monitor compatibility, as well as support for HDR, DirectStorage, NVIDIA DLSS 3, and AMD FSR 3.1 technologies. Minimum system requirements include Windows 10, an Intel Core i3-8100 (or AMD Ryzen 3 1300X), an N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 (or AMD Radeon RX 5500 XT), and 16 GB of RAM.
